SACRAMENTO – California Lottery players from across the state won a total of $1,115,500 on “The Big Spin®” show that aired Saturday, December 4, 2004.
Aurelia Macias from Seaside was the lucky Spin-Spin-Spin contestant to win BIG! The fun began when Ms. Macias, a waitress, spun the wheel and the ball landed in the $1 million slot…making her California’s latest millionaire! Macias said, “This is unbelievable! Last night, I told my husband that I was going to win big…and it actually happened!” Macias will continue to shop at the La Morenita in Seaside where she bought her lucky ticket and plans to pay off her home and share the wealth with her family.
The first player at the “Fantasy 5 Dream Machine” was Roger Elliott, a salesman from Lakewood, who was grateful to win $55,000. Elliott purchased his ticket at John’s Liquor in
Lakewood. Elliott plans to use his winnings towards a vacation at Pebble Beach. Finishing the “Fantasy 5 Dream Machine” lucky streak was Jesse Oliver, a police officer from Los Angeles. Oliver, who bought his ticket at Bluebird Liquor in Hawthorne, won $10,000 in prize money and plans to go on a long cruise with his winnings.
From the “Aces High” round, Rheba Highducheck, a Glendora resident won the right to spin the wheel. Ms. Highducheck, who bought her Big Spin Scratchers® ticket at Rima Grocery & Deli in Covina, spun the wheel for $30,000. “This is wonderful! Now I can afford to travel,” said Highducheck.
